WingsUp! expands to B.C. with Vancouver opening

Ontario-based chicken wing chain WingsUp! has opened its first British Columbia location in Vancouver, marking the company’s debut on the West Coast as part of a broader national expansion.

Founded in 2005, WingsUp! currently operates more than 36 locations in Ontario and recently entered the Calgary market. The Vancouver opening is a strategic step in the company’s coast-to-coast growth plans.

“Vancouver is a natural fit for our brand,” said Darren Czarnogorski, president of WingsUp!, in a statement. “The city’s appreciation for fresh, high-quality food aligns with our core values.”

The company’s business model features small-format stores built for dense urban areas, with all delivery services handled in-house rather than through third-party providers. Orders are available for pickup, delivery or catering.

WingsUp!’s menu focuses on made-to-order, never-frozen wings and includes flavours such as Jamaican Hot, Medium BBQ, Honey Garlic Parmesan and Texas Tequila. The brand positions itself as a comfort food option that offers convenience for both lunch customers and at-home diners.

WingsUp! is actively recruiting franchisees in British Columbia to support its westward expansion. The company highlights a low-barrier entry model for prospective operators, with support in training, marketing and supply chain logistics.

“This is just the beginning for us in British Columbia,” Czarnogorski said. “We see strong potential in this market and look forward to expanding our footprint across the province.”
